N-(3-Hydroxypyridin-3-yl)pivalamide is a chemical compound that belongs to the class of amide compounds. It is derived from pivalic acid, a branched-chain carboxylic acid, and contains a pyridin-3-yl group with a hydroxyl substituent at the 3-position. N-(3-HYDROXYPYRIDIN-3-YL)PIVALAMIDE has potential applications in the pharmaceutical and chemical industries, particularly in the development of new drugs or as a building block for the synthesis of other organic compounds. It may also possess biological activity and could be used as a reagent in organic synthesis. Additionally, its structure and properties make it an interesting target for research and investigation in the fields of medicinal chemistry and chemical biology.

Check Digit Verification of cas no

The CAS Registry Mumber 177744-83-1 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,7,7,7,4 and 4 respectively; the second part has 2 digits, 8 and 3 respectively.
Calculate Digit Verification of CAS Registry Number 177744-83:
(8*1)+(7*7)+(6*7)+(5*7)+(4*4)+(3*4)+(2*8)+(1*3)=181
181 % 10 = 1
So 177744-83-1 is a valid CAS Registry Number.

The first enantioselective synthesis of 4-acetyl-3(R)- and 3(S)-(hydroxymethyl)-3,4-dihydro-2H-pyrido[3,2-b]oxazine

Henry,Guillaumet,Pujol

, p. 1465 - 1468 (2004)

A novel short and enantioselective synthetic approach to pyridobenzoxazines is reported in which (R)- and (S)-3-(hydroxymethyl)-3,4- dihydro-2H-pyrido[3,2-b][1,4]oxazine were first synthesized from readily available chiral glycidyl derivatives.
